1. Overview

Ultraviolet filter is a special optical filter that can absorb or reflect ultraviolet rays and is widely used in many fields. With the development of science and technology and the growth of people's demand for optical technology, UV filters play an important role in scientific research, production, life and other aspects.

2. Application Areas

1. Photography and photography: In photography and photography, UV filters are used to eliminate the influence of ultraviolet rays on the image, protect the lens, and improve the quality of the photo.
2. Optical instruments: In optical instruments such as telescopes and microscopes, ultraviolet filters are used to filter out ultraviolet interference and improve the observation effect.
3. Biology and Medicine: In biology and medical research, UV filters are used to observe and analyze UV fluorescence of biological samples, such as DNA analysis, cell observation, etc.
Environmental protection: In environmental monitoring, UV filters are used to detect and analyze pollutants in the atmosphere, such as ozone layer monitoring.
5. Solar energy utilization: In the field of solar energy, ultraviolet filters are used to improve the efficiency of solar panels and reduce the damage of ultraviolet rays to the battery.

3. technical characteristics

Ultraviolet filter has the characteristics of high transmittance, high absorption and high reflectivity. Its performance is stable, not easy to age, and has a long service life. In addition, the UV filter also has the characteristics of anti-corrosion and anti-pollution, and can adapt to various harsh environments.
